#365262 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#365262 is composed of 21.2% red, 32.2%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.9% cyan, 16.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 61.6% black. It has a hue angle of 201.8 degrees, a saturation of 28.9% and a lightness of 29.8%. #365262 color hex could be obtained by blending #6ca4c4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#365262 color description : Very dark desaturated blue.
#365262 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#365262 has RGB values of R:54, G:82,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0.16, Y:0,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 3560034.
